Has anyone read Rashomon and 17 other stories?
published by Penguin Classics
Ryunosuke was a genius at short stories, I particularly enjoyed "In a Bamboo Grove" with the contradictory statements relating to a discovery of a body found amongs the bamboo and cedar. The murdered mans account was the most vivid.
But the best story no doubt - and probably the best short story i have ever read... had to be "Hell Screen"... wow, the impact was as if i read an entire novel after i finished that, with such character development and what an ending!
